Job Description Heyday Farm is a family-run 25-acre sustainable and historic farm on Bainbridge Island. In addition to championing and growing local food, our focus is on building community and educating. By respecting the environment and its limits, we grow food of the highest integrity, taste and quality. Our name comes from our commitment to increase our collective nourishment just as farms did back in their heydays.

Position Description  

We are currently looking for a Kitchen Assistant. While everyone is encouraged to engage in many aspects of our diversified farm, this position is mainly responsible for assisting in our commercial farm kitchen. This position reports to our chef. The position includes meal prep and service for guests at the farm as well as a supporting role in cooking classes given at the farm. This includes educating guests about the food that is produced on the farm. Another important aspect of the position is a leading role in production of value-added products featuring meats (including charcuterie), eggs and produce produced on the farm. There is the possibility of helping out in our creamery making cheese if and when time allows. This position includes two days off a week. We are seeking someone who has the ability and willingness to work evenings and traditional weekends. This position has good growth and leadership opportunities.
